This collection consists of images, spreadsheets, reports, GIS and site record data from archaeological assessments by Museum of London Archaeology (MOLA). Work occurred at Watermark West Quay, Southampton, Hampshire between 2013 and 2016. The first watching brief on geotechnical boreholes and trial pits successfully identified the stratigraphic sequence from ground surface to depths of 35m or 50m below ground level. Pleistocene (Ice Age) river gravels, alluvial deposits and marshland peats were recorded at various locations. A separate geoarchaeological evaluation of two rotary boreholes recovered a suite of environmental samples from the varied alluvial sequences recorded across the site underwent post-excavation assessment. In the second watching brief Tidal mudflats were located on site and driven into the mudflats were a series of timber posts, parallel to the City wall forming solid structure(s) built out to the west of the town wall. Reused moulded stone fragments were found within the walls. The remains of an early 19th century pier and associated reclamation dumps, abutting the town walls were found at the northern end of the site.
